Output e700fe09b0d8a515fec973ebd4f45ef46e16f3289cb7d2413b2c80fcd27562f0:19

value
166403025
script pubkey
OP_0 OP_PUSHBYTES_20 3c8578bce7b790a698ccc1bdabb9a7d6c82919c0
address
bc1q8jzh3088k7g2dxxvcx76hwd86myzjxwqeen0s9
transaction
e700fe09b0d8a515fec973ebd4f45ef46e16f3289cb7d2413b2c80fcd27562f0
confirmations
276474
spent
true